Students use this set of worksheets to create a fact book for their favorite planet in the solar system.

Solar System Activities for Kids 🪐📒

With this activity, students will research and record specific information about the planets on the worksheet. A copy of the planet research page can be printed for each planet and then compiled to make a complete factbook. Information that students will need to complete includes:

  • planet diameter (mi.)
  • distance from the Sun (millions of mi.)
  • rotation time (hours)
  • orbit/revolution time (days)
  • average temperature (°F)
  • number of moons
  • ring system (yes/no)
  • main composition (rock/gas/ice)
  • a fun fact

Where in the Universe? 🌌

Students can also learn their place in space by recording their “cosmic address”:

  • street
  • city
  • state
  • country
  • planet
  • star system (Orion Arm)
  • galaxy (Milky Way)
  • Cluster (Virgo)
  • the Universe
